A Heartwarming Display of Unity
In New Delhi, a group of Hindus showed kindness to protesters near Jamia Millia Islamia University by forming a human chain to distribute water and snacks. This act of communal harmony was captured in viral videos and showed unity during a time of rising tensions. The Hindus carried posters that read “Hindu-Muslim Bhai Bhai” (Hindus and Muslims are brothers), and they stood patiently in line to help.

Assisting Protesters in Need
Many protesters were fasting due to the heatwave, and the Hindus’ gesture was a much-needed relief. The protesters were demanding policy reforms, and the demonstration was organized by student groups. Despite heavy police presence, the atmosphere remained peaceful as the two communities interacted positively.

A Beacon of Hope
Social media users praised the act, calling it a “beacon of hope” in divisive times. Local leaders commended the effort and urged others to follow suit. This incident reminded people of India’s shared humanity and the importance of unity. It showed that even in difficult times, people from different communities can come together and show kindness to one another.
